什么样的信息请求时,解决的一个问题上的客户的框使用桌面应用程序?

StackOverflow https://stackoverflow.com/questions/2357639

我们写一Windows桌面应用程序,是安装在一个几千人计算机,我们没有访问。当这些用户报告的一个错误,即使该说明是相当彻底,还有其他信息可能是有帮助的。

我们目前正在一个自动化反馈剂,这意味着我们将有机会获得非常详细的信息。但是,像一个孩子在一家糖果店,我们不知道从哪里开始。 什么样的信息将包括在您的反馈意见包装在相同的情况吗? 什么是有用的,以帮助我们重现有的错误?

我们迄今是:

  • 该版本的数量我们的应用程序,
  • 操作系统和操作系统版本的数量
  • 代理信息
  • .净版和更新数
  • 信息的具体要我们的应用程序(如。数据的版本)
  • 访问和错误记录

注意,这是类似于 这个问题, 但是我们没有那么多的兴趣获得信息时的程序的崩溃,因为我们是作为当的用户经验的一个错误。

编辑:澄清:不要为什么样的信息的用户应该得到在这种情况下的一个错误,而是什么样的信息,我们应该聚集 programmaticaly?

有帮助吗?

解决方案

即使你有所有的信息、再现的问题可能是困难的。当用户介绍它们如何创建的错误,他们往往错误的关键步骤--很难为他们知道什么领域都是至关重要的当他们不知道的内部运作的应用程序。你可能想要实现的一种方式跟踪用户行动,例如根级别活动处理或某些其他手段-如果你撤销/恢复功能那我肯定这就足够了。然后您可以包括最后的(x)步骤的行动链中的误差的报告。

其他提示

编辑:我想我看错了你的问题。我以为你在谈论什么样的信息,以获得从客户报告的一个错误,而不是已经计划什么我描述了在这里。我会离开,它为参考。

在类似的情况下,尽管用户较少,我们的应用程序得到了一个"包日志为支持"按钮,这将创建一个压缩文件的所有记录文件,以及目前开设的项目文件,如果有的话。所有其他信息你说是已经部分的一个日志的文件。这种方法,客户能够方便地发送邮件给我们,这可以从主要的应用程序窗口而不打开一个项目文件或连接到一个网络接口,这是两个要点那东西可以去错误的。这使得它如此容易得多,比依赖用户提供反馈意见"的手"。

另外,的确切步骤的重现的问题必须是可用的。大多数通常是在项目文件本身(其是在邮政编文件,我们得到的),只有少数几个步骤缺失。

事情似乎是重要的,为此,其他比你已经列出:

  • 用户/客户的信息。这可能有助于权限的问题。你可能想包括类似时区、区域设置Windows的主题。
  • 应用程序配置,包括它在哪里安装。
  • 如前所述,目前的文件的用户使用,因为这可能导致的问题。
  • 用户设置,即数据的应用存储每户。看见奇怪的事情与这些。MRU名单也可能有帮助的。

除了基本的国家的应用(版本,配置,等等), 最重要的信息是:

  • 的步骤(s)需要重现差错或错误,包括投入使用,如果可能的
  • 预期的产出
  • 实际产出
  • 联系信息的情况下需要采取后续行动(如果你的软件消耗匿名)

这将是足够的信息,以解决99.9%的问题。对于剩下的,跟踪和获得任何详细信息将有助于你认为解决的问题(其中,我们希望,将远远更好的理解这一点)。

许可以下: CC-BY-SA归因
不隶属于 StackOverflow
scroll top